About Hendrik Jan Roest

Hendrik Jan Roest is a scholar working on Parasitology, Microbiology and Virology, having authored 9 papers that have together received 431 indexed citations. Recurring topics across this work include Vector-borne infectious diseases (3 papers), Yersinia bacterium, plague, ectoparasites research (2 papers) and Rabies epidemiology and control (2 papers). The work is most often cited by research in Parasitology (270 citations), Infectious Diseases (243 citations) and Ecology, Evolution, Behavior and Systematics (168 citations). Hendrik Jan Roest has collaborated with scholars based in Netherlands, United Kingdom and Germany. Frequent co-authors include Ana Afonso, Wim van der Hoek, Katharina D.C. Stärk, Arjan Stegeman, Annie Rodolakis, Simon J. More, Richard Thiéry, Milen Georgiev, P. Vellema and Heinrich Neubauer. Their work appears in journals such as Scientific Reports, Journal of Clinical Microbiology and Eurosurveillance.
